Output 729ba201fa3089c6d4938c346db30e8a4ed9045381668f4017f313b5b9b1480c:0

value
17998967
script pubkey
OP_0 OP_PUSHBYTES_20 851c3476490a0f5bb6cc8495a902829770b70f64
address
bc1qs5wrgajfpg84hdkvsj26jq5zjactwrmy7xdf9j
transaction
729ba201fa3089c6d4938c346db30e8a4ed9045381668f4017f313b5b9b1480c
spent
true